The idea is a simple one terracotta heats up slowly and retains the heat quite well so if you take three or two terracotta pots and put them one inside the other with space for air to move in between then the terracotta absorbs the heat from one single candle. With an engineering background it s hard to see how the math can work out on a project like this. Natural candle powered terracotta heater will warm you for cheap. Terracotta retains heat for a good while longer.
